MicroStrategy Drops $250 Bitcoin Jordans. But You Can’t Buy With Crypto

Covered by 2 sources · 2 articles

MicroStrategy has launched a line of custom Bitcoin-themed Air Jordan 1 sneakers priced at $250 per pair through its store, featuring a 53-item catalog. The footwear is available for purchase via card payment only, with no cryptocurrency payment option despite the Bitcoin branding. The move arrives as Nike's parent company faces significant stock pressure over the past year.

The initiative appears positioned to capitalize on crossover appeal between sneaker culture and crypto enthusiasts, though the friction between the Bitcoin aesthetic and traditional payment rails underscores the gap between crypto marketing and actual adoption in consumer retail.
